Informationen zum Autor Tristan Bernays is a writer and performer from London. His work includes Boudica (Shakespeare's Globe, 2017); Testament (VAULT Festival, London, 2017); Frankenstein (Watermill Theatre/Wilton’s Musical Hall ); Teddy (Southwark Playhouse; Best New Musical at the 2016 Off West End Awards); The Bread & The Beer (Soho Theatre/UK tour); and Coffin (King’s Head Theatre, London). (Author photo by Michael Shelford) Klappentext Tristan Bernays' Old Fools is a surprising and touching play about a couple, their experience of Alzheimer's, and their enduring efforts to hold their relationship together through the years.
